Nymphs are designed to resemble the immature form of aquatic insects and small crustaceans.
There is no question that for catching trout, nymphs are the most important fly in your selection of flies.

Dark Olive Pupa flyfishing Nymph fly trout Pattern imitates this stage of the caddis development especially as it drifts to the surface just before emerging into an adult. Many pupa are olive in color and form part of a trout.
The Caddis Nimph may look simple but it is one of the most effective patterns around. The profile is suggestive of a number of insects and simply looks like something good to eat.
The Green Hares Ear Caddis Pupa may look simple but it is one of the most effective patterns around.
The Universal nimph can be used to imitate a wide range of Trout foods including Caddis and Hoglouse. This version includes a heavy weight head for depth. Kamasan B-170 Fly Hooks.
The peacock is one of the most successful nymphs. Sometimes that odd pattern works for no logical reason whatsoever. “The Peacock” has proved to be incredible when it comes to brown trout, and the legend has it that it also catches Sea-Trout and Salmon.
When you are at new place and don’t know where to start, tie this caddis larva on to your leader and you are on half way.
The Pheasant Tail is a classic fly in the world of fly fishing. This fly aims to imitate small insects of the baetis family and is designed to fish close to the stones at the bottom of the river.
